dm persistent data: eliminate unnecessary return values

dm_bm_unlock and dm_tm_unlock return an integer value but the returned
value is always 0.  The calling code sometimes checks the return value
and sometimes doesn't.

Eliminate these unnecessary return values and also the checks for them.
